Patents by Inventor Mark A. Richardson
Mark A. Richardson has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20240336129Abstract: An active air module for a vehicle. The module includes an active air feature having at least an open and closed position. Air is allowed to enter when in the open position and airflow is at least partially blocked in the closed position. A soft actuator such as a twisted coiled polymer actuator apparatus is used for actuation of the active air feature from the closed position to the open position.Type: ApplicationFiled: April 5, 2024Publication date: October 10, 2024Applicant: Magna Exteriors Inc.Inventors: Daniel R. Vander Sluis, Braendon R. Lindberg, Jeffrey Caraway, Mark A. Richardson
-
Patent number: 11899928Abstract: Disclosed herein are related to systems and methods for providing inputs through a virtual keyboard with an adaptive language model. In one approach, one or more processors determine whether a user intended to provide semantically meaningful characters or not, when providing a hand motion or a hand pose with respect to a virtual keyboard. The virtual keyboard may be located on a surface without physical keys. In one approach, the one or more processors determine an input to the virtual keyboard based on the hand motion or the hand pose. In one approach, the one or more processors determine weight of a language model according to the determined user intention. In one approach, the one or more processors modify the detected input according to the determined weight of the language model.Type: GrantFiled: May 9, 2022Date of Patent: February 13, 2024Assignee: Meta Platforms Technologies, LLCInventors: Mark A. Richardson, Robert Y. Wang
-
Patent number: 11455657Abstract: One or more embodiments of the disclosure include methods and systems that allows for improved user navigation within a group of content items. For example, a content navigation system can identify a content item within a group of content items to provide to a user in response to a user interaction. In some embodiments, the content navigation system can identify a content item to provide to the user based on one or more factors, such as a characteristic of a user interaction and a relevance of a content item. In addition, the content navigation system can strategically provide advertisement content items to a user by adjusting one or more factors with respect to advertisement content items.Type: GrantFiled: December 14, 2020Date of Patent: September 27, 2022Assignee: Meta Platforms, Inc.Inventor: Mark A. Richardson
-
Publication number: 20220261150Abstract: Disclosed herein are related to systems and methods for providing inputs through a virtual keyboard with an adaptive language model. In one approach, one or more processors determine whether a user intended to provide semantically meaningful characters or not, when providing a hand motion or a hand pose with respect to a virtual keyboard. The virtual keyboard may be located on a surface without physical keys. In one approach, the one or more processors determine an input to the virtual keyboard based on the hand motion or the hand pose. In one approach, the one or more processors determine weight of a language model according to the determined user intention. In one approach, the one or more processors modify the detected input according to the determined weight of the language model.Type: ApplicationFiled: May 9, 2022Publication date: August 18, 2022Inventors: Mark A. Richardson, Robert Y. Wang
-
Patent number: 11327651Abstract: Disclosed herein are related to systems and methods for providing inputs through a virtual keyboard with an adaptive language model. In one approach, one or more processors determine whether a user intended to provide semantically meaningful characters or not, when providing a hand motion or a hand pose with respect to a virtual keyboard. The virtual keyboard may be located on a surface without physical keys. In one approach, the one or more processors determine an input to the virtual keyboard based on the hand motion or the hand pose. In one approach, the one or more processors determine weight of a language model according to the determined user intention. In one approach, the one or more processors modify the detected input according to the determined weight of the language model.Type: GrantFiled: February 12, 2020Date of Patent: May 10, 2022Assignee: Facebook Technologies, LLCInventors: Mark A. Richardson, Robert Y. Wang
-
Publication number: 20210247900Abstract: Disclosed herein are related to systems and methods for providing inputs through a virtual keyboard with an adaptive language model. In one approach, one or more processors determine whether a user intended to provide semantically meaningful characters or not, when providing a hand motion or a hand pose with respect to a virtual keyboard. The virtual keyboard may be located on a surface without physical keys. In one approach, the one or more processors determine an input to the virtual keyboard based on the hand motion or the hand pose. In one approach, the one or more processors determine weight of a language model according to the determined user intention. In one approach, the one or more processors modify the detected input according to the determined weight of the language model.Type: ApplicationFiled: February 12, 2020Publication date: August 12, 2021Inventors: Mark A. Richardson, Robert Y. Wang
-
Publication number: 20210224850Abstract: One or more embodiments of the disclosure include methods and systems that allows for improved user navigation within a group of content items. For example, a content navigation system can identify a content item within a group of content items to provide to a user in response to a user interaction. In some embodiments, the content navigation system can identify a content item to provide to the user based on one or more factors, such as a characteristic of a user interaction and a relevance of a content item. In addition, the content navigation system can strategically provide advertisement content items to a user by adjusting one or more factors with respect to advertisement content items.Type: ApplicationFiled: December 14, 2020Publication date: July 22, 2021Inventor: Mark A. Richardson
-
Patent number: 10867320Abstract: One or more embodiments of the disclosure include methods and systems that allows for improved user navigation within a group of content items. For example, a content navigation system can identify a content item within a group of content items to provide to a user in response to a user interaction. In some embodiments, the content navigation system can identify a content item to provide to the user based on one or more factors, such as a characteristic of a user interaction and a relevance of a content item. In addition, the content navigation system can strategically provide advertisement content items to a user by adjusting one or more factors with respect to advertisement content items.Type: GrantFiled: September 5, 2017Date of Patent: December 15, 2020Assignee: FACEBOOK, INC.Inventor: Mark A. Richardson
-
Patent number: 10719173Abstract: A transcription engine transcribes input received from an augmented reality keyboard based on a sequence of hand poses performed by a user when typing. A hand pose generator analyzes video of the user typing to generate the sequence of hand poses. The transcription engine implements a set of transcription models to generate a series of keystrokes based on the sequence of hand poses. Each keystroke in the series may correspond to one or more hand poses in the sequence of hand poses. The transcription engine monitors the behavior of the user and selects between transcription models depending on the attention level of the user. The transcription engine may select a first transcription model when the user types in a focused manner and then select a second transcription model when the user types in a less focused, conversational manner.Type: GrantFiled: April 4, 2018Date of Patent: July 21, 2020Assignee: FACEBOOK TECHNOLOGIES, LLCInventors: Mark A Richardson, Robert Y Wang
-
Publication number: 20190310688Abstract: A transcription engine transcribes input received from an augmented reality keyboard based on a sequence of hand poses performed by a user when typing. A hand pose generator analyzes video of the user typing to generate the sequence of hand poses. The transcription engine implements a set of transcription models to generate a series of keystrokes based on the sequence of hand poses. Each keystroke in the series may correspond to one or more hand poses in the sequence of hand poses. The transcription engine monitors the behavior of the user and selects between transcription models depending on the attention level of the user. The transcription engine may select a first transcription model when the user types in a focused manner and then select a second transcription model when the user types in a less focused, conversational manner.Type: ApplicationFiled: April 4, 2018Publication date: October 10, 2019Inventors: Mark A. Richardson, Robert Y. Wang
-
Publication number: 20170364951Abstract: One or more embodiments of the disclosure include methods and systems that allows for improved user navigation within a group of content items. For example, a content navigation system can identify a content item within a group of content items to provide to a user in response to a user interaction. In some embodiments, the content navigation system can identify a content item to provide to the user based on one or more factors, such as a characteristic of a user interaction and a relevance of a content item. In addition, the content navigation system can strategically provide advertisement content items to a user by adjusting one or more factors with respect to advertisement content items.Type: ApplicationFiled: September 5, 2017Publication date: December 21, 2017Inventor: Mark A. Richardson
-
Patent number: 9754286Abstract: One or more embodiments of the disclosure include methods and systems that allows for improved user navigation within a group of content items. For example, a content navigation system can identify a content item within a group of content items to provide to a user in response to a user interaction. In some embodiments, the content navigation system can identify a content item to provide to the user based on one or more factors, such as a characteristic of a user interaction and a relevance of a content item. In addition, the content navigation system can strategically provide advertisement content items to a user by adjusting one or more factors with respect to advertisement content items.Type: GrantFiled: September 22, 2014Date of Patent: September 5, 2017Assignee: FACEBOOK, INC.Inventor: Mark A. Richardson
-
Publication number: 20160086219Abstract: One or more embodiments of the disclosure include methods and systems that allows for improved user navigation within a group of content items. For example, a content navigation system can identify a content item within a group of content items to provide to a user in response to a user interaction. In some embodiments, the content navigation system can identify a content item to provide to the user based on one or more factors, such as a characteristic of a user interaction and a relevance of a content item. In addition, the content navigation system can strategically provide advertisement content items to a user by adjusting one or more factors with respect to advertisement content items.Type: ApplicationFiled: September 22, 2014Publication date: March 24, 2016Inventor: Mark A. Richardson
-
Publication number: 20160026936Abstract: Exemplary methods, apparatuses, and systems present, to a first user of a network service, a description of an event, a selectable option for the first user to indicate an intention to attend the event, and an indication of users of the network service that intend to attend the event. An indication that the first user intends to attend the event and a set of one or more users the first user is willing to take as passengers to the event are received. An indication that a second user of the network service intends to attend the event is also received. The first user is presented as a potential driver to the second user in response to receiving the indication that the second user intends to attend the event and determining the second user is within the set of one or more users.Type: ApplicationFiled: July 25, 2014Publication date: January 28, 2016Inventors: Mark A. Richardson, Alexandru Petrescu, Michael Adam Finch
-
Publication number: 20110080262Abstract: A locating system for locating a specific subject among a number of possible subjects having an RFID tag attached to subjects which, when interrogated by an RFID reader, provides a unique identification code. A database containing information about subscribers including a list of RFID tag codes associated with the subjects of interest is included in the system. Transceivers having an RFID reader and a processor responsive to the transceiver and the RFID reader are also included in the locating system for locating a subject of interest. When the transceivers receive RFID code transmitted via the communications network, the transceiver is activated to transmit data to any nearby RFID tags. Upon receipt of a response from the RFID tag, the transceivers transmit the tag data to the communications network so that the subject of interest can be located.Type: ApplicationFiled: August 29, 2005Publication date: April 7, 2011Inventors: Mark A. Richardson, Kenneth H. Stueve
-
Patent number: 6575265Abstract: A gear assembly comprising a linear differential disposed at the gear assembly wherein the linear differential has a predetermined ratio from an input shaft to an output shaft, the ratio being adjustable by axially rotating the linear differential. A method of adjusting steering output as compared to steering input, which comprises powering a motor in operable communication with a worm and worm gear mechanism and rotating the worm and the worm gear mechanism fixed to a differential carrier. The method also comprises rotating the differential carrier, which comprises an input sun gear meshed with input differential planet gear, an input differential planet gear meshed with an output differential planet gear, and an output sun gear meshed with the output differential planet gear. The method further comprises rotating the output sun gear fixed to a differential output shaft.Type: GrantFiled: March 19, 2001Date of Patent: June 10, 2003Assignee: Delphi Technologies, Inc.Inventors: Mark A. Richardson, Brian Jerome Magnus, Chad David Bauer, Jeremy L. Cradit
-
Publication number: 20020029922Abstract: A gear assembly comprising a linear differential disposed at the gear assembly wherein the linear differential has a predetermined ratio from an input shaft to an output shaft, the ratio being adjustable by axially rotating the linear differential. A method of adjusting steering output as compared to steering input, which comprises powering a motor in operable communication with a worm and worm gear mechanism and rotating the worm and the worm gear mechanism fixed to a differential carrier. The method also comprises rotating the differential carrier, which comprises an input sun gear meshed with input differential planet gear, an input differential planet gear meshed with an output differential planet gear, and an output sun gear meshed with the output differential planet gear. The method further comprises rotating the output sun gear fixed to a differential output shaft.Type: ApplicationFiled: March 19, 2001Publication date: March 14, 2002Inventors: Mark A. Richardson, Brian Jerome Magnus, Chad David Bauer, Jeremy L. Cradit
-
Patent number: 6186885Abstract: An integrated HVAC system for an automotive vehicle, including mating forward and rearward shells each have mating portions of left and right duct arms for delivering conditioned air therethrough. The mating shells define a central enclosure within which a drop-in heater core module may be operatively placed.Type: GrantFiled: February 18, 1999Date of Patent: February 13, 2001Assignee: Ford Motor CompanyInventors: Kenneth K. Ahn, Mark A. Richardson
-
Patent number: 5945320Abstract: A DNA molecule isolated from Streptomyces ambofaciens encodes the multi-functional proteins which direct the synthesis of the polyketide platenolide.Type: GrantFiled: February 21, 1997Date of Patent: August 31, 1999Assignee: Eli Lilly and CompanyInventors: Stanley G. Burgett, Stuart A. Kuhstoss, Ramachandra N. Rao, Mark A. Richardson, Paul R. Rosteck, Jr.
-
Patent number: 5190871Abstract: The present invention provides a method for transforming an actinomycete with an integrating vector which has the advantages of high transformation rates into a broad host range, site-specific integration, and stable maintenance without antibiotic selection. Also provided are methods for the increased production of antibiotics and for the production of hybrid antibiotics.Type: GrantFiled: June 12, 1989Date of Patent: March 2, 1993Assignee: Eli Lilly and CompanyInventors: Karen L. Cox, Stuart A. Kuhstoss, R. Nagaraja Rao, Mark A. Richardson, Brigitte E. Schoner, Eugene T. Seno